Education Empowerment: Yakurr 1 Lawmaker Invests ₦10M in JAMB Applicants

YAKURR – Hon. Cyril Omini, the representative for Yakurr 1 State Constituency and Chair of the Finance and Appropriation Committee in the Cross River State House of Assembly, has allocated ₦10 million to cover application and registration expenses for prospective candidates in his constituency ahead of the 2025 Joint Admission and Matriculation Board (JAMB) examinations.

The funding initiative, which includes the provision of application forms along with financial support to cover travel and logistics expenses, is aimed at ensuring that financial barriers do not prevent young people from accessing higher education.

“Education remains one of the most powerful tools for transforming lives and communities. My goal is to ensure that every young person in my constituency has the opportunity to further their education and achieve their dreams without financial barriers,” Hon. Omini said.

The ₦10 million fund is intended to ease the burden of costs associated with the exam process by covering expenses for travel to examination and thumbprinting centers both within the state and beyond.

The initiative has been warmly received by local stakeholders who view it as a significant investment in the future of the community.

Mrs Rita Oden, the Special Adviser to the Chairman of Yakurr LGA on Women Affairs, commended the lawmaker’s ongoing commitment to educational development.

“I am personally very happy because this is not the first time he is doing this. It takes a large heart to give back to your people, and Hon. Cyril is doing it wonderfully well,” she said. “You can see the excitement on the faces of these young people, and many of them are even from outside his constituency.”

Beneficiaries expressed gratitude for the support. Miss Joy Edet, one of the recipients, said, “This initiative has given me the chance to sit for JAMB without worrying about the cost. I sincerely appreciate Hon. Omini for his support and encouragement.”

Similarly, Ubi Onun described the measure as one of the most impactful initiatives he had witnessed in Yakurr Constituency 1, adding, “I want to say a very big thank you to Hon. Cyril Omini. He has done very well, and I pray that God continues to bless him.”

Mrs Grace Usani, who attended the event on behalf of her daughter, also expressed her appreciation, stating that experiencing the lawmaker’s support firsthand felt like a dream. “I feel so glad that we have somebody like Hon. Cyril Omini helping people out. I have heard about his empowerment programs, but seeing it in action is truly inspiring,” she said.

The ₦10 million allocation underscores Hon. Cyril Omini’s commitment to breaking down financial barriers to education and fostering a future where every young person can pursue their academic aspirations without hindrance.

Converseer reports that Hon. Omini has been carrying out the initiative even before becoming a Lawmaker.
